By way of example, if you move your eyes to the proper, the Visible world should shift across your retinas towards the remaining inside a predictable way. The tectum compares the predicted Visible signals to the actual visual input, to make certain that your movements are heading as planned. These computations are terribly advanced and but very well worth the added energy with the reward to movement Command. In fish and amphibians, the tectum is the pinnacle of sophistication and the biggest Element of the Mind. A frog features a very good simulation of alone.

A variety of studies have shown that activity in Major sensory regions of the Mind will not be ample to produce consciousness: it is possible for topics to report an absence of recognition even though spots including the Most important Visible cortex (V1) clearly show apparent electrical responses to the stimulus.[111] Bigger Mind places are observed as a lot more promising, Specially the prefrontal cortex, which is involved with An array of bigger cognitive features collectively referred to as executive capabilities.[112] There is sizeable evidence that a "top rated-down" stream of neural activity (i.e., activity propagating with the frontal cortex to sensory places) is a lot more predictive of conscious recognition than a "base-up" flow of activity.[113] The prefrontal cortex isn't the only prospect area, nevertheless: studies by Nikos Logothetis and his colleagues have revealed, for example, that visually responsive neurons in areas of the temporal lobe replicate the visual notion in the specific situation when conflicting Visible images are offered to different eyes (i.

A more refined experiment took benefit of a effectively-explained “double dissociation Visible awareness” undertaking in which people execute in fully reverse strategies whether or not they have consciously processed a stimulus or if they have unconsciously processed it (this differs from not perceiving the event, as there is actually a stimulus-related reaction). When implementing a version of this job to macaques, these animals produced double-dissociation responses A great deal akin to those in humans, which implies that there is actually a difference between conscious and unconscious processing On this species.
